jdbc连接mysql不成功怎么解决
如果你无法成功使用JDBC连接MySQL数据库,请尝试以下步骤来解决问题:1. 首先,请确保你已经正确安装了MySQL数据库,并且数据库服务正在运行。2. 确认你的JDBC驱动程序已正确导入到你的项目中。你可以从MySQL官方网站上下载JDBC驱动程序,并将其添加到你的项目的类路径下。3. 确认你的连接URL、用户名和密码是正确的。在使用JDBC连接MySQL时,连接URL的格式通常是:jdbc:mysql://hos...
mysql多节点部署的方法是什么
MySQL多节点部署的方法有以下几种: 主从复制:将一个节点作为主节点,其他节点作为从节点,主节点负责写入数据,从节点负责读取数据。主节点将写入的数据复制到从节点上,并保持数据的一致性。主从复制可以提高读取性能和数据冗余。 主主复制:将多个节点都配置为主节点,每个主节点都负责写入和复制数据,可以提高写入性能和数据冗余。主主复制需要配置双向复制,确保数据的一致性。 分片:将数据分散存储在多个节点上,每个节点只负...
mysql联合索引查询的方法是什么
要使用MySQL联合索引进行查询,您需要使用联合索引的所有列,并将它们按照索引的顺序列出来。以下是使用联合索引进行查询的方法:1. 创建联合索引:CREATEINDEXindex_nameONtable_name(column1,column2,...);2. 编写查询语句,并在WHERE子句中使用联合索引的所有列:SELECT*FROMtable_nameWHEREcolumn1=value1ANDcolumn2=v...
PostgreSQL和mysql的区别是什么
PostgreSQL和MySQL是两种常见的关系型数据库管理系统(RDBMS)。以下是它们之间的一些主要区别: 数据库类型:PostgreSQL是一个对象关系型数据库管理系统(ORDBMS),而MySQL是一个关系型数据库管理系统(RDBMS)。这意味着PostgreSQL具有更多的高级功能,如复杂的数据类型、触发器和存储过程等。 数据完整性:PostgreSQL支持更严格的数据完整性,包括外键、主键和唯一约束等...
mysql在服务中无法启动或禁止怎么解决
如果MySQL在服务中无法启动或禁止,可以尝试以下解决方案:1. 检查日志文件:查看MySQL的错误日志文件,通常命名为"error.log",位于MySQL的安装目录下。日志文件中可能包含有关启动或禁止失败的详细信息,根据日志中的错误消息来解决问题。2. 确保端口未被占用:检查是否有其他应用程序占用了MySQL所使用的端口(默认是3306)。如果端口被占用,可以更改MySQL的配置文件(my.cnf)中的端口号,并重...
mysql source命令导入报错怎么解决
当使用MySQL的source命令导入数据时,可能会遇到一些错误。以下是一些常见的错误及其解决方法: ERROR 1044 (42000): Access denied for user ‘username’@‘localhost’ to database ‘database_name’ 这个错误表示当前用户没有访问指定数据库的权限。可以尝试使用GRANT语句授予用户适当的权限,或者使用具有足够权限的用户来导入数据。...
mysql两个表格数据怎么共用
要共用两个表格的数据,可以使用MySQL中的JOIN操作来实现。 假设有以下两个表格: 表格1:employees +----+-------+--------+ | id | name | salary | +----+-------+--------+ | 1 | John | 5000 | | 2 | Mary | 6000 | | 3 | Peter | 7000 | +----+---...
Python爬取数据存入MySQL的方法是什么
Python爬取数据存入MySQL的方法有以下几种: 使用Python的MySQLdb模块:MySQLdb是Python与MySQL数据库交互的接口模块,可以通过安装MySQLdb模块并导入使用,通过执行SQL语句将爬取到的数据插入MySQL数据库中。 import MySQLdb # 建立数据库连接 db = MySQLdb.connect(host="localhost", user="root", passwd...
mysql新建数据库失败怎么解决
要解决MySQL新建数据库失败的问题,可以尝试以下几种方法: 检查MySQL服务是否正常运行。确保MySQL服务已经启动,可以通过命令行或者服务管理器进行检查和启动。 检查MySQL的配置文件。确认MySQL的配置文件中是否包含正确的数据库路径和权限配置。 检查MySQL用户权限。使用合适的MySQL用户登录,并确保该用户具有创建数据库的权限。 检查磁盘空间。确保磁盘上有足够的空间来创建新的数据库。...
docker部署mysql如何访问
要访问在Docker中部署的MySQL,您可以执行以下步骤: 启动MySQL容器:使用以下命令在Docker中启动MySQL容器: docker run --name mysql -e MYSQL_ROOT_PASSWORD=your_password -p 3306:3306 -d mysql:latest 这将在后台运行MySQL容器,并将主机的3306端口映射到容器的3306端口。 连接到MySQL容器:...
mysql如何关闭binlog日志
MySQL可以通过修改配置文件或者使用命令来关闭binlog日志。 方法一:修改配置文件 打开MySQL配置文件my.cnf(Linux系统)或者my.ini(Windows系统)。 找到并注释掉或删除以下行: log_bin = /var/log/mysql/mysql-bin.log 保存并关闭配置文件。 重启MySQL服务使配置生效。 方法二:使用命令 登录MySQL命令行客户端。 执行以下命令关闭binlog...
MySQL怎么查看表结构和注释
要查看MySQL中的表结构和注释,可以使用以下两种方法: 使用DESCRIBE命令: DESCRIBE table_name; 这将显示表的列名、数据类型、是否为主键、默认值等信息。 使用SHOW CREATE TABLE命令: SHOW CREATE TABLE table_name; 这将显示创建表的完整语句,包括列定义、主键约束、索引等信息。 备注:以上两种方法都不会显示表的注释。如果想查看表的注释,可以使用...
MySQL使用mysqldump备份数据库
要使用mysqldump备份MySQL数据库,可以按照以下步骤操作: 打开命令行工具(如Windows的cmd或Linux的终端)。 输入以下命令来导出数据库:mysqldump -u 用户名 -p 数据库名 > 备份文件名.sql 其中,用户名为连接数据库时使用的用户名,数据库名为要备份的数据库名称,备份文件名为保存备份数据的文件名称,.sql为文件扩展名。 回车后,系统会要求输入密码。输入正确密码后,系统会...
mysql报1064错误怎么解决
MySQL报1064错误通常是由于输入的SQL语句语法错误所引起的。要解决这个问题,可以尝试以下几个方法: 检查SQL语句:仔细检查SQL语句的拼写和语法,确保没有拼写错误或者遗漏了必要的关键字。可以使用MySQL的命令行工具或者其他图形化工具来执行SQL语句。 确保关键字正确:确保SQL语句中使用的关键字和函数的拼写正确,并且使用正确的语法结构。 检查引号:如果SQL语句中包含字符串或者日期等类型的值,确保...
docker怎么连接外部mysql数据库
你可以使用Docker容器来连接外部的MySQL数据库,以下是一些步骤: 首先,确保你已经安装了Docker和Docker Compose。 创建一个Docker Compose文件,例如docker-compose.yml,并将以下内容添加到文件中: version: '3' services: app: build: . ports: - 8080:8080 envi...
